#dbd3f5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#dbd3f5 is composed of 85.9% red, 82.7% green and 96.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 10.6% cyan, 13.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 3.9% black. It has a hue angle of 254.1 degrees, a saturation of 63% and a lightness of 89.4%. #dbd3f5 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#b7a7eb. Closest websafe color is: #ccccff.

#dbd3f5 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#dbd3f5 has RGB values of R:219, G:211, B:245 and CMYK values of C:0.11, M:0.14, Y:0,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 14406645.
